The LTC
®
3221 family are micropower charge pump DC/DC
converters that produce a regulated output at up to 60mA.
The input voltage range is 1.8V to 5.5V. Extremely low
operating current (8µA typical at no load) and low external
parts count (one flying capacitor and two small bypass
capacitors at V
IN
and V
OUT
) make them ideally suited for
small, battery-powered applications.
The LTC3221 family includes fixed 5V and 3.3V output
versions plus an adjustable version. All parts operate
as Burst Mode
®
switched capacitor voltage doublers
to achieve ultralow quiescent current. The chips use a
controlled current to supply the output and will survive
a continuous short-circuit from V
OUT
to GND. The FB pin
of the adjustable LTC3221 can be used to program the
desired output voltage.
The LTC3221 family is available in a low profile (0.75mm)
2mm
×
2mm 6-pin DFN package.
